Macy's

Macy's, an American department store chain is famous for its flagship store in Herald Square. It is one of the largest chains in the United States. It offers a broad range of items, including clothing accessories, shoes and cosmetics. In addition to its main store, Threaded Insert For metal the retailer has a number of other locations across the nation.

Rowland Hussey Macy opened a department store in New York City in the 1800s. Macy is credited with a number of innovations that have helped shape the department store that we see today. These include the use of only cash and creating the one-price system. He also standardized newspaper pricing in the US and was among the first stores to offer money-back guarantees. He also invented a made to measure operation for clothing and the Christmas window display, which remains a Macy's tradition today.

Nordstrom

Nordstrom is a department store that sells fashionable clothes and accessories for men, women, children, and babies. The company has its headquarters in Seattle, Washington and operates a chain throughout the US. The company also offers online shopping and a mobile app. The products offered by the company include clothing and footwear, handbags and accessories such as bath and body products, home accessories and accents as well as products for beauty and food. Nordstrom also provides a variety of services, such as styling, pickups for alteration orders and dining services. It also has a retail brand called Zella.

The e-commerce sales of Nordstrom account for more than 30% of its total revenue.
